What is Anemia of Chronic Disease?
Anemia of chronic disease (ACD) is a specific type of anemia that develops in the context of a chronic medical condition. This condition primarily arises due to the body’s response to inflammation and disease processes that hinder the production of red blood cells or alter iron metabolism. It is characterized by a moderate decrease in hemoglobin levels, which can vary depending on the severity and duration of the chronic illness.
ACD differs from other forms of anemia, particularly iron deficiency anemia. While iron deficiency anemia is often attributed to inadequate iron levels due to nutritional deficiencies, blood loss, or malabsorption, ACD typically occurs in patients with chronic diseases such as infections, autoimmune disorders, or malignancies. The key distinction lies in the body’s iron stores; in ACD, iron is often sequestered in storage sites and is not readily available for hemoglobin production, despite adequate or even elevated total body iron stores.
Furthermore, ACD contrasts with anemia resulting from acute blood loss. In cases of acute hemorrhage, the body experiences a sudden loss of red blood cells, which leads to a rapid decline in hemoglobin levels. On the other hand, ACD develops gradually and is often seen in patients who have ongoing health issues, with clinical symptoms that may develop over weeks to months.
The underlying mechanisms of anemia of chronic disease are multi-faceted, involving cytokines, hepcidin production, and the activity of the immune system. Inflammatory cytokines can suppress erythropoiesis, which directly affects the bone marrow’s ability to produce red blood cells. Additionally, an increase in hepcidin production leads to impaired intestinal iron absorption and a reduction in iron release from macrophages, further compounding the anemic state. Understanding these mechanisms is crucial for effective management and treatment approaches for individuals suffering from this form of anemia.
Causes of Anemia of Chronic Disease
Anemia of Chronic Disease (ACD) is frequently linked to a variety of chronic conditions that exert significant physiological stress on the body. Understanding the causes of ACD requires examining how chronic illnesses disrupt the delicate balance of red blood cell production and iron metabolism. Among the primary contributors to ACD are autoimmune diseases, chronic infections, malignancies, and other chronic inflammatory disorders. Each of these conditions can create an environment that leads to anemia.
Autoimmune diseases, such as rheumatoid arthritis and lupus, are well-documented causes of ACD. In these disorders, the immune system inadvertently targets the body’s own tissues, resulting in prolonged inflammation. This chronic inflammatory state prompts the release of certain cytokines that can interfere with erythropoiesis, or red blood cell production, by inhibiting erythropoietin, a key hormone in this process. Furthermore, these cytokines can alter iron metabolism, leading to a sequestration of iron and reducing its availability for hemoglobin synthesis.
Chronic infections are also significant contributors to ACD. Conditions such as tuberculosis and HIV can initiate a sustained immune response that not only impairs the bone marrow’s ability to produce red blood cells but also disrupts the normal regulation of iron. The body, in an effort to limit the availability of iron to pathogens, redistributes iron stores and decreases absorption, which can exacerbate anemia.
Moreover, cancers, particularly hematological malignancies like leukemia or lymphoma, can directly affect the bone marrow, leading to reduced production of erythrocytes. The presence of tumors, whether solid or liquid, may release substances that further inhibit normal blood cell production.
Chronic inflammatory conditions, such as chronic kidney disease, can also lead to ACD by affecting erythropoietin production and contributing to iron deficiency. In summary, the interplay between chronic diseases and anemia highlights the complex physiological changes that occur, necessitating a comprehensive understanding for effective management.
Symptoms of Anemia of Chronic Disease
Anemia of Chronic Disease (ACD) manifests through a variety of symptoms that often mirror those associated with the underlying chronic condition, complicating the diagnostic process. One of the most prevalent symptoms of ACD is fatigue. This fatigue is typically the result of insufficient red blood cell production and decreased hemoglobin levels, which lead to inadequate oxygen supply to the body’s tissues. As a consequence, individuals may experience an inability to perform daily activities that were once manageable.
Another common symptom linked to ACD is weakness. Patients often report a general sense of weakness or a feeling of being easily fatigued, even with minimal exertion. The physiological basis for this weakness can be attributed to the body’s inability to efficiently transport oxygen due to reduced red blood cell counts, which can significantly impact overall physical performance.
Pale skin is also frequently observed in individuals suffering from anemia of chronic disease. This pallor occurs due to lower levels of hemoglobin, the protein responsible for carrying oxygen in the blood, which contributes to the skin’s appearance. Furthermore, this symptom can be indicative of other underlying health issues, making it essential for healthcare providers to consider it in conjunction with other manifestations.
Shortness of breath is yet another significant symptom of ACD. Patients may find themselves experiencing dyspnea, particularly during physical activity, which arises from the body’s inability to meet its oxygen demands. The severity of this symptom can vary depending on the individual and the extent of their underlying chronic disease.
In essence, the symptoms of anemia of chronic disease are diverse and intricately linked to the chronic conditions affecting the individual, thereby necessitating careful clinical evaluation for accurate diagnosis and effective management.
Diagnosis of Anemia of Chronic Disease
The diagnosis of Anemia of Chronic Disease (ACD) necessitates a comprehensive approach that includes detailed medical history, physical examination, and several targeted laboratory tests. Initially, a healthcare professional will gather information regarding the patient’s medical history, which is paramount in understanding any underlying chronic conditions that may be contributing to the anemia. Common chronic diseases associated with ACD include inflammatory disorders, chronic infections, and malignancies. This context aids in forming a coherent clinical picture.
A physical examination is also essential. The clinician typically looks for signs of anemia, such as pallor and fatigue, which may indicate the severity of the condition. Following this, specific laboratory tests are employed to establish a definitive diagnosis. A Complete Blood Count (CBC) test is often the first step; it reveals key indicators of anemia, such as hemoglobin levels and red blood cell (RBC) counts. In the context of ACD, these parameters may exhibit moderate reductions without the numerical extremities characteristic of iron deficiency anemia.
Iron studies are also crucial for diagnosing ACD. These tests evaluate serum iron, ferritin, and total iron-binding capacity (TIBC). In ACD, patients typically present with normal or elevated ferritin levels and low TIBC, which distinguishes it from iron deficiency anemia. Additionally, inflammatory markers such as C-reactive protein (CRP) and erythrocyte sedimentation rate (ESR) are assessed to determine the presence and extent of inflammation, further supporting the diagnosis of ACD.
Healthcare professionals play a critical role in diagnosing ACD, as they must differentiate it from other types of anemia. The analytical evaluation of symptoms, coupled with laboratory findings, enables an accurate diagnosis and guides subsequent management strategies tailored to the individual’s needs.
Treatment Options for Anemia of Chronic Disease
Anemia of chronic disease (ACD) is a multifaceted condition that arises as a result of underlying chronic illnesses, such as infections, inflammatory disorders, or malignancies. Effective management of ACD necessitates a comprehensive approach, primarily focusing on the treatment of the underlying disease. Addressing the root cause often results in the amelioration of anemia and the associated symptoms. Therefore, a thorough diagnostic workup is essential to determine the appropriate treatment strategies.
One of the primary treatment options for individuals with ACD involves the use of erythropoiesis-stimulating agents (ESAs). These agents stimulate the bone marrow to produce more red blood cells, which can enhance hemoglobin levels in affected patients. ESAs may prove particularly beneficial for those suffering from renal disease or certain cancers, where anemia is a direct result of low erythropoietin production. However, careful monitoring is essential, as inappropriate use can lead to serious complications.
Iron supplementation is another potential treatment for individuals experiencing ACD. While iron levels can be normal or even elevated in many cases due to inflammation, some patients may still benefit from iron therapy, particularly if their iron stores are low. The administration of oral or intravenous iron can help improve hemoglobin levels and alleviate fatigue. However, healthcare providers must evaluate iron status before initiating treatment to avoid unnecessary supplementation.
Dietary modifications also play a critical role in managing ACD. A balanced diet rich in iron, vitamins, and minerals can support overall health and encourage better erythropoiesis. Foods such as lean meats, legumes, leafy greens, and fortified cereals should be incorporated to enhance nutritional intake. In certain severe cases of ACD, blood transfusions may be required to rapidly increase hemoglobin levels, alleviating symptoms such as severe fatigue or breathlessness.
Lifestyle Changes and Home Remedies
Managing Anemia of Chronic Disease (ACD) effectively often requires practical lifestyle adjustments that can improve overall health and potentially alleviate symptoms. One of the primary strategies is dietary modification, with a focus on enhancing iron intake and overall nutrition. Foods rich in iron, such as lean meats, fish, poultry, legumes, and dark leafy greens, should be incorporated into daily meals. Additionally, the consumption of vitamin C-rich foods, like citrus fruits and bell peppers, can bolster iron absorption, particularly when combined with iron-rich foods. It is beneficial to avoid foods and beverages high in calcium, such as dairy, during meals that are high in iron, as calcium can inhibit iron absorption.
Regular physical activity is another vital component in managing ACD. Engaging in moderate exercise, such as walking, swimming, or cycling, helps maintain overall physical health, boosts energy levels, and reduces fatigue associated with anemia. It is crucial for individuals to establish a tailored exercise routine balanced with their specific health needs and capabilities, ensuring not to overexert themselves, especially during periods of increased fatigue.
Stress management techniques play a significant role in supporting those with ACD. Chronic stress can exacerbate anemia symptoms, making it important to adopt practices such as mindfulness, meditation, or yoga. These approaches not only promote relaxation but may also enhance emotional well-being, ultimately supporting overall health. Moreover, some individuals may explore alternative therapies, such as acupuncture or herbal supplements. While these can complement traditional treatments, it is imperative to consult with healthcare professionals before integrating them into one’s routine to ensure safety and efficacy.
Ultimately, adopting these lifestyle changes and home remedies can provide significant support in managing ACD and improving quality of life. By focusing on nutrition, exercise, and mental well-being, individuals may find a more holistic approach to addressing their condition.
Preventing Anemia of Chronic Disease
Preventing Anemia of Chronic Disease (ACD) is a crucial endeavor, especially for individuals diagnosed with chronic conditions. The management of chronic diseases, such as diabetes, rheumatoid arthritis, or chronic kidney disease, plays a significant role in minimizing the risk of developing ACD. Regular medical check-ups are essential as they allow healthcare providers to monitor patients’ overall health and promptly address any emerging issues that may contribute to anemia.
Routine blood tests should be part of these check-ups. These assessments can help identify any abnormal changes in red blood cell production or hemoglobin levels. By monitoring hemoglobin and hematocrit values, healthcare providers can take proactive steps to prevent the development of anemia. Individuals should also maintain an open line of communication with their healthcare team, sharing any new symptoms or changes in their condition that could signal the onset of anemia.
Proactive management of chronic diseases is critical for preventing ACD. This includes adhering to prescribed treatment plans, such as medication regimens and lifestyle modifications. For example, patients with kidney disease may need to focus on preventing further kidney damage, whereas those with autoimmune disorders might incorporate anti-inflammatory diets and physical activities designed to enhance their overall health. Such efforts can help sustain the body’s ability to produce red blood cells effectively.
Diet plays an important role in supporting blood health, and individuals should strive to consume a well-balanced diet rich in essential nutrients. Iron, vitamin B12, and folate are particularly significant for red blood cell production. Consulting with a dietician can provide tailored advice on dietary choices that support blood health and mitigate the risk of ACD.
